Dehydrating food isn’t just a trendy kitchen hack—it’s been around for centuries. Preserving fruits, veggies, meats, and even herbs through drying allows you to extend their shelf life while locking in nutrients.

Today, with food dehydrators more affordable and versatile than ever before, home cooks are experimenting with delicious recipes that transform the way we snack, season, and meal prep.

Fruits (20 Recipes)

Dehydrated fruit makes addictive snacks or toppers.

  1. Cinnamon Apple Chips – Thinly sliced apples with a sprinkle of cinnamon, dried until crisp.
  2. Strawberry Fruit Leather – Sweet, tangy, and perfect for kids.
  3. Mango Chews – Nature’s candy with no additives required.
  4. Pineapple Rings – Bursting with tropical flavor.
  5. Crispy Banana Chips – Fantastic as a snack or cereal add-in.

Don’t stop there—try peaches, pears, kiwi, or citrus slices for something unique.

Vegetables (20 Recipes)

Transform veggies into chips, powders, or soup base ingredients.

  1. Zucchini Chips – Season with sea salt and garlic, then crisp them up.
  2. Carrot Fries – Sweet, satisfying, and guilt-free.
  3. Kale Chips – A classic with endless seasoning options.
  4. Tomato Slices – Sprinkle with oregano for pizza-flavored joy.
  5. Bell Pepper Sticks – Crunchy and great for dipping.

Ideas worth exploring include broccoli, spinach, or sweet potato variations.

Meats (20 Recipes)

Dehydrated meats are protein-packed and perfect for on-the-go snacking.

  1. Classic Beef Jerky – Marinate with soy sauce, Worcestershire, garlic powder, and pepper.
  2. Teriyaki Turkey Jerky – Savory with a hint of sweetness.
  3. Spicy Chicken Strips – Dust with cayenne and paprika for a fiery kick.
  4. Pork Tenderloin Slices – Marinate in BBQ sauce for smoky flavors.
  5. Venison Jerky – A hunter’s favorite for lean, flavorful snacking.

Keep a stash for hiking trips or busy days when you need an easy protein boost.

Herbs (20 Recipes)

Drying herbs preserves flavors and guarantees your dishes taste freshly seasoned.

  1. Basil – Bright and aromatic, perfect for Italian recipes.
  2. Oregano – A drying essential for pizza night.
  3. Cilantro – Crush into salsas or sprinkle in soups.
  4. Mint – Perfect for teas or desserts.
  5. Rosemary – Elevates meats, potatoes, and bread.

Store them in airtight jars to lock in freshness.

Snacks & Treats (20 Recipes)

Get creative with your dehydrator and whip up unique treats!

  1. Trail Mix Granola Bars – A combo of dried fruit, nuts, and light honey glaze.
  2. Savory Eggplant Chips – A smoky twist on veggie snacks.
  3. Yogurt Bites – Use flavored yogurt frozen and dried into chewy gems.
  4. Crispy Chickpeas – Spiced with cumin and paprika for a savory crunch.
  5. Coconut Crisps – Sweet and salty with just the right crunch.
